The Chief Medical Officer says people planning to spend time with family over Christmas should start limiting their social contacts now.

It comes as health officials say the Covid-19 situation is stable - but that the progress so far is fragile.

15 additional deaths have been reported, 10 of which occurred this month, with 310 new cases of the disease.
